Dual attraction refers to the experience of being attracted to multiple genders simultaneously or sequentially. This phenomenon is often misunderstood as either bisexuality or polyamory, but it has unique characteristics that make it distinct from these terms. Dual attraction can involve a range of emotions, including physical desire, romantic feelings, and friendship. It can also be fluid, meaning that someone's preference for gender may change over time. In this way, dual attraction illuminates relational and ethical complexity by challenging traditional definitions of love and intimacy.

One of the key features of dual attraction is its ability to blur boundaries between genders. Someone who experiences dual attraction might feel drawn to both men and women, or they might prefer people who are nonbinary or genderqueer. This can lead to complicated dynamics within relationships, as partners navigate their own identities and desires while trying to meet each other's needs.

If one partner feels more comfortable dating exclusively within one gender, while the other prefers to date multiple genders, there may be tension around commitment and fidelity.

Another aspect of dual attraction is the potential for jealousy and competition between partners. Because dual-attracted individuals can have feelings for multiple people at once, there is always a risk of conflicts arising when those people overlap in some way. This can create a sense of insecurity and mistrust within relationships, especially if both partners do not understand how to communicate openly about their desires and boundaries.

Dual attraction can also enrich relationships by allowing for greater flexibility and creativity. Partners can explore different types of intimacy and connection with each other, and learn from their diverse experiences. They can also build trust and respect through honest communication and mutual support. By embracing diversity and openness, couples can deepen their understanding of themselves and each other, creating a stronger foundation for their relationship.
